Venkataswami, J.\n<\/p>\n<p>     The respondent as a landlord of the suit premises filed<br \/>\nCase No.  70\/2 of  1987 before\tthe Rent  Controller,  Solan<br \/>\n(H.P.) for  eviction of\t the appellant.\t   The\tgrounds\t for<br \/>\neviction were (a) the appellant defaulted in payment of rent<br \/>\nfrom 1.1.87  up to  the\t date  of  filing  of  the  eviction<br \/>\npetition and  (b) that\tthe  suit  premises  was  bona\tfide<br \/>\nrequired by  him for  the purpose  of  building\/re-building,<br \/>\nwhich cannot  be carried  out  without\tthe  premises  being<br \/>\nvacated.  We may at once state that the ground of default in<br \/>\npayment of  rent was  found against the landlord by the Rent<br \/>\nController and\tthe same  was not  pursued by  the  landlord<br \/>\nbefore the  Appellant Authority and the High Court.  We are,<br \/>\ntherefore, concerned  only with\t the  ground  of  bona\tfide<br \/>\nrequirement of\tthe premises for building\/re-building by the<br \/>\nlandlord.  This ground is covered by Section 14(3)(c) of the<br \/>\nHimachal Pradesh  Urban Rent  Control Act, 1987 (hereinafter<br \/>\ncalled the &#8216;Act&#8217;).\n<\/p>\n<p>     The Rent  Controller on  the basis of evidence oral and<br \/>\ndocumentary and placing reliance on a judgment of this Court<br \/>\nin Metalware  And Co.  Ltd. etc.  Vs. Bansilal Sarma And Co.<br \/>\netc. &#8211;\t(1979) 3  SCC 398,  found that there was no evidence<br \/>\nregarding the  condition of the building and consequent bona<br \/>\nfide  requirement   of\t the   same   for   demolition\t and<br \/>\nreconstruction and  that factor\t being a  vital one  for the<br \/>\npurpose of  granting an\t order for  eviction  dismissed\t the<br \/>\npetition.\n<\/p>\n<p>     The respondent-landlord  aggrieved by  the dismissal of<br \/>\nthe eviction  petition preferred  C.M.A. No.20-8\/4  of\t1990<br \/>\nbefore\tthe  Appellate\tAuthority,  Solan.    The  Appellate<br \/>\nAuthority on  an analysis of Section 14(3)(c) of the Act and<br \/>\nin view\t of the\t fact  that  the  appellant-tenant  had\t not<br \/>\ndisputed the availability of the resources with the landlord<br \/>\nand compliance\tof other  requirements except  regarding the<br \/>\ndilapidated condition  of the  building, found that the Rent<br \/>\nController  was\t  not  right   in  dismissing  the  eviction<br \/>\npetition.   According to the Appellate Authority, the ruling<br \/>\nof this\t Court in Metalware &amp; Co. case rendered interpreting<br \/>\nSection 14(1)(b)  of the Tamil Nadu Rent Control Act may not<br \/>\napply to the relevant provision in the Himachal Pradesh Act,<br \/>\nwhich did  not contemplate  the condition of the building as<br \/>\none of\tthe relevant  factors for  the purpose\tof  ordering<br \/>\neviction on  the facts of the case.  The appellate Authority<br \/>\nalso found  that what  was let\tout to\tthe tenant was not a<br \/>\n&#8216;building&#8217; as  defined in  Section 2(b)\t of the\t act, but an<br \/>\nopen plot  measuring 100  x 95\twith a\tshed thereon.\t The<br \/>\nAppellate Authority  found that\t Section 14(3)(c) of the Act<br \/>\napplies to  the tenanted  land as well and, therefore, it is<br \/>\nall the\t more reason  that the Rent Controller was not right<br \/>\nin applying  the decision  of this  Court in Metalware &amp; Co.<br \/>\ncase. On  the basis  of the above conclusions, the Appellate<br \/>\nAuthority by  reversing the  decision of the Rent Controller<br \/>\nallowed the application for eviction.\n<\/p>\n<p>     The appellant  aggrieved by  the order of the Appellate<br \/>\nAuthority preferred a Revision to the High Court of Himachal<br \/>\nPradesh at  Shimla.   The learned  Judge confirmed  the view<br \/>\ntaken by the Appellate Authority and dismissed the Revision.<br \/>\nHence, the present appeal by special leave.\n<\/p>\n<p>     Mr. Sree  Kumar,  learned\tcounsel\t appearing  for\t the<br \/>\nappellant-tenant, reitereated  that the ruling of this Court<br \/>\nin Metalware  &amp; Co.  case. which  has been  considered in  a<br \/>\nrecent Constitution  Bench judgment  of this  Court in Vijay<br \/>\nSingh &amp;\t Ors. Vs.  Vijayalakshmi Ammal\t&#8211; (1996)  6 SCC 475,<br \/>\nsquarely applies  to the  facts of this case and, therefore,<br \/>\nthe Appellate Authority and the High Court were not right in<br \/>\ncoming to  the conclusion  that the  ruling of this Court in<br \/>\nMetalware &amp;  Co. case  will not\t apply to  the facts of this<br \/>\ncase.\n<\/p>\n<p>     Mr. Salman\t Khursheed, learned  senior counsel  for the<br \/>\nrespondent, submitted that the Appellate Authority was right<br \/>\nin holding  that on  the basis\tof the\tlanguage employed in<br \/>\nSection\t 14(3)(c)  of  the  Act\t there\tis  no\twarrant\t for<br \/>\ncontending that\t the condition of the building was since qua<br \/>\nnon for ordering eviction of the tenant from the building.\n<\/p>\n<p>     It is  obvious from  the rival submissions that we have<br \/>\nto  set\t  out  Section\titself\tbefore\tproceeding  further.<br \/>\nSection 14(3)(c) of the Act reads as follows:\n<\/p>\n<blockquote><p>     &#8220;14(3) &#8211;  A landlord  may apply  to<br \/>\n     the   Controller\tfor   an   order<br \/>\n     directing the  tenant  to\tput  the<br \/>\n     landlord in possession:-<br \/>\n     &#8230;&#8230;&#8230;&#8230;&#8230;&#8230;&#8230;&#8230;&#8230;&#8230;&#8230;..<br \/>\n     &#8230;&#8230;&#8230;&#8230;&#8230;&#8230;&#8230;\n<\/p><\/blockquote>\n<blockquote><p>     (c) in  the case of any building or<br \/>\n     rented land,  if he  requires it to<br \/>\n     carry out\tany building work at the<br \/>\n     instance of the Government or local<br \/>\n     authority or  any Improvement Trust<br \/>\n     under    some     improvement    or<br \/>\n     development scheme\t or  if\t it  has<br \/>\n     become unsafe  or unfit  for  human<br \/>\n     habitation or  is required bonafide<br \/>\n     by him  for  carrying  out\t repairs<br \/>\n     which cannot be carried out without<br \/>\n     the building  or rented  land being<br \/>\n     vacated or\t that  the  building  or<br \/>\n     rented land is required bonafide by<br \/>\n     him for  the purpose of building or<br \/>\n     re-building or  making thereto  any<br \/>\n     substantial      additions\t      or<br \/>\n     alterations and  that such building<br \/>\n     or\t re-building   or  addition   or<br \/>\n     alteration cannot\tbe  carried  out<br \/>\n     without the building or rented land<br \/>\n     being vacated.<\/p><\/blockquote>\n<p>     A careful\treading of  the above Section will show that<br \/>\nthe    Section\t   contemplates\t   different\t independent<br \/>\nsituations\/circumstances enabling  the landlord to apply for<br \/>\neviction of  a tenant.\t  Those\t different  and\t independent<br \/>\nsituations\/circumstances can be set out as follows:-\n<\/p>\n<blockquote><p>     &#8220;(1) When the tenanted premises are<br \/>\n     required by  the landlord\tto carry<br \/>\n     out  any\tbuilding  work\t at  the<br \/>\n     instance of the Government or local<br \/>\n     authority or  any Improvement Trust<br \/>\n     under    some     improvement    or<br \/>\n     development scheme; or\n<\/p><\/blockquote>\n<blockquote><p>     (ii)  When\t the  tenanted\tpremises<br \/>\n     have become  unsafe  or  unfit  for<br \/>\n     human habitation; or\n<\/p><\/blockquote>\n<blockquote><p>     (iii) When\t the  tenanted\tpremises<br \/>\n     are  required   bona  fide\t by  the<br \/>\n     landlord\t       for  carrying out<br \/>\n     repairs which cannot be carried out<br \/>\n     without  such   tenanted\tpremises<br \/>\n     being vacated; or\n<\/p><\/blockquote>\n<blockquote><p>     (iv) When the tenanted premises are<br \/>\n     required bonafide\tby the\tlandlord<br \/>\n     for   purposes   of   building   or<br \/>\n     rebuilding or  making  thereto  any<br \/>\n     substantial      additions\t      or<br \/>\n     alterations and  that sch\tbuilding<br \/>\n     or\t rebuilding   or   addition   or<br \/>\n     alteration cannot\tbe  carried  out<br \/>\n     without the building or rented land<br \/>\n     being vacated.&#8221;<\/p><\/blockquote>\n<p>     From the  above analysis,\tit will\t be  seen  that\t the<br \/>\ncondition of  the building is required to be considered when<br \/>\nthe application\t falls under  the above\t mentioned  Category\n<\/p>\n<p>(ii).\tAdmittedly, the\t application  for  eviction  in\t the<br \/>\npresent case  falls under  Category (iv)  and  there  is  no<br \/>\nrequirement in\tsuch cases  to go  into the condition of the<br \/>\nbuilding. It  is true  that this  Court has  held  that\t the<br \/>\nrequirement of\tthe condition  of the  building is  a  vital<br \/>\nfactor whether\tsuch requirement  is specifically  stated in<br \/>\nthe Section or not   It must be remembered that the decision<br \/>\nof  this  Court\t was  rendered\twhile  interpreting  Section<br \/>\n14(1)(b) of  the Tamil Nadu Act which is not in pari materia<br \/>\nwith the Himachal Pradesh Act.\tIn other words, there are no<br \/>\ndifferent categories  as set out above in the Tamil Nadu Act<br \/>\nas in Himachal Pradesh Act.\n<\/p>\n<p>     In addition  to the  above, as  found by  the Appellate<br \/>\nAuthority, the lease was with reference to land with a shed.<br \/>\nAs a  matter of\t fact, the  appellant-tenant as\t RW-1 in his<br \/>\nchief examination has stated as follows:-\n<\/p>\n<blockquote><p>     &#8220;The land\tin dispute  was taken by<br \/>\n     me on rent in 1973.  This place was<br \/>\n     100&#8242; X  95&#8242;.   The rent  amount was<br \/>\n     Rs. 250\/-\tper month.   This  place<br \/>\n     was given to me for workshop.&#8221;<\/p><\/blockquote>\n<p>     As noted  above, Section  14(3)(C) applies\t to tenanted<br \/>\nland as\t well and the tenant has not questioned the capacity<br \/>\nof the\tlandlord to raise the construction or the bona fides<br \/>\nof the landlord to do so.\n<\/p>\n<p>     In the  result, we\t do not find any ground to interfere<br \/>\nwith the  confirming order  of the  High Court.\t  The appeal<br \/>\nfails and is dismissed with no order as to costs.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Supreme Court of India Prem Chand Alias Prem Nath vs Smt.
